Chelsea like £45m player at Premier League rivals

Well-respected journalist Simon Phillips has just claimed via his Substack that Chelsea have put Crystal Palace’s Eberechi Eze on their wishlist for this summer.

He’s explained that Palace are very keen to keep their 25-year-old attacking midfielder, who’s been included in a 33-man England squad that will need to be reduced to 26 players before this summer’s Euro 2024 tournament.

It is understood that Chelsea scouts have regularly attended Palace matches this season, where they’ve been really impressed by both Eze and teammate Michael Olise.

Apparently, Eze has a market value of £45m and his club will fight to keep him at Selhurst Park. However, it’s unlikely they would stand in his way of moving if an appropriate offer was received this summer.

Eberechi Eze has previously been linked with the Blues

Interestingly, this isn’t the first time that Palace’s talisman has received transfer links with Chelsea.

It’s no great surprise his name has popped up again either after another great season in Palace colours. He scored 11 goals and made six assists in only 31 club appearances this campaign.

Phillips reported via Substack in August 2023 that Chelsea actually made an enquiry about signing Palace’s Eze. So, will they go a step further with their interest this summer?

Palace playmaker is ‘unique’

Whether he’s starting as a No 10 or a left-winger, Eze regularly impacts matches in the Premier League.

He’s got the kind of dribbling and change of direction that opposition players must hate coming up against.

Speaking via TNT Sports back in January of this year, Rio Ferdinand waxed lyrical about Eze’s technical ability, plus his “unique” journey to the top division after playing in lower leagues earlier in his career.

Ferdinand commented on Eze: “His journey has been unique. He’s had disappointments in his academy life, released from clubs, found a new journey and a different pathway for himself. He’s got to this level and now he’s an England international.

“This kid, no disrespect to Palace, could go on and play for one of the top teams. He’s got that individual brilliance; he’s got the awareness when he’s dribbling to keep his head up and bring others into play. I speak to other players that play against him, and they say he’s such an elusive player, unpredictable in the way that he carries the ball, but also [his strength].”
